What Is the Cost of Living Near Yakima?

Understanding the cost of living near Yakima is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at Klickitat County.
Yakima's Cost of Living Index is approximately 90.2 (9.8% less expensive than US average; 19.2% less than WA average). Central WA agricultural hub, affordable housing. Yakima Transit. When planning your budget based on a salary from Klickitat County, consider these typical monthly expenses:
Expense Category Estimated Monthly Cost Key Considerations / Notes
Housing (1-BR Apt Rent) $900 - $1,300+ A significant portion of Klickitat County salary. Location choices impact this heavily.
Utilities (Basic) $100 - $190 Electricity, Heating, Cooling, Water etc.
Public Transportation $30 (Yakima Transit monthly pass) Essential for most commuters; car ownership is costly.
Groceries (Single Person) $390 - $570 Can be higher with more dining out or specialty stores.
Personal & Leisure $330 - $630+ Dining out, entertainment, shopping. Highly variable.
Healthcare (Individual) $360 - $670+ Varies significantly by plan & employer contribution.
Subtotal (Excluding Taxes) $2,110 - $3,360+ This subtotal does not include income taxes (federal, state, local), which can significantly impact your take-home pay.
